«Inspection» and «The Number of Rebekah» — the continuation of the tetralogy «Shadows of the Past». The first part of the book continues the story of young von Tille, a guard in Dachau, which began in the novel «Wiland». He has climbed the career ladder, arrived for an inspection in Auschwitz, and interacts with his colleagues, trying to understand at what point the beautiful dreams of revenge of the great nation turned into a cult of Moloch. «The Number of Rebekah» presents the events from the perspective of Wiland's beloved — a German Jewish woman, a prisoner of the concentration camp. Oksana Kirillova spent several years working with archives: the characters she created interact with real historical figures. The books in the series cover the period from the 1930s to the 1990s, with major events occurring in Germany and Russia. At the same time, it is not a narrative burdened with dry historical facts, but an exciting story of tragic love, disillusioned ideals, and unexpected turns.
